SOFT FROSTED SUGAR COOKIES RECIPE | ALLRECIPES



Soft Frosted Sugar Cookies Recipe | Allrecipes image

These taste just like Loft House sugar cookies and are just as soft.

Provided by Ashley Bluth

Categories     Desserts    Cookies    Sugar Cookie Recipes

Total Time 1 hours 0 minutes

Prep Time 20 minutes

Cook Time 10 minutes

Yield 3 dozen cookies

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 cup vegetable shortening
1 cup white sugar
¼ cup milk
2 e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
3 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on baking soda
¼ cup butter
3 cups confectioners' sugar
1?½ teaspoons vanilla extract, or more to taste
2 tablespoons milk, or as needed

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Beat vegetable shortening, white sugar, 1/4 cup milk, eggs, and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ract together in a bowl. Whisk flour, salt, and baking soda in a separate bowl. Slowly beat flour mixture into shortening mixture to make a smooth dough.
  • Roll dough out 1/4-inch thick on a floured work surface and cut into shapes. Arrange cookies on baking sheets.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until cookies are firm, about 10 minutes. Let cool.
  • Beat butter, confectioners' sugar, 1 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ract, and 2 tablespoons milk in a bowl with an electric mixer on high speed until frosting is spreadable and slightly fluffy. Frost cooled cookies.

FROST BITE COOKIES RECIPE - FOOD.COM



Frost Bite Cookies Recipe - Food.com image

Make and share this Frost Bite Cookies recipe from Food.com.

Total Time 29 minutes

Prep Time 15 minutes

Cook Time 14 minutes

Yield 48 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

3/4 cup raisins
3 tablespoons orange juice or 3 tablespoons orange-flavored liqueur
1/2 cup butter, at room temperature
3/4 cup sugar
1 large egg
2 teaspoons orange zest
1 cup all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 1/2 cups rolled oats
8 ounces white chocolate chips
1 teaspoon vegetable oil or 1 teaspoon shortening

Steps:

  • Combine orange juice (or liquor) and raisins in a small bowl and let stand overnight (or--if you are like me and want to make them right now--cover and microwave for 1 minute, cool covered).
  • Beat butter and sugar in a large bowl until fluffy.
  • Beat in egg and orange peel.
  • Combine flour and baking soda in another large bowl and stir into butter mixture.
  • Add raisins, any soaking liquid, and oats and mix well.
  • Drop dough by rounded teaspoonfuls onto greased baking sheets, spacing 2 inches apart and flattening slightly.
  • Bake at 350°F 10 to 12 minutes.
  • Transfer to racks and cool completely.
  • Microwave chocolate and oil 3 to 4 minutes on low power in a small deep bowl, stirring once.
  • Let stand 2 minutes, stir until smooth.
  • Dip one-third of cookie in chocolate and set on waxed paper.
  • Chill until chocolate is firm.
  • STRIP VERSION:.
  • Divide dough into 4 equal portions.
  • Place 2 portions, at least 6 inches apart, on baking sheet.
  • Pat each portion into a 12-inch-long log with well-floured hands (dough will be sticky) and flatten each log to 1 1/2 inches wide.
  • Bake until golden brown, 12 to 14 minutes.
  • Cool on baking sheets 2 minutes.
  • Cut logs diagonally into 1-inch-wide strips.
  • Follow directions for dipping cookies.

The frosted possibilities are endless! ## Baking Tips _Start with slightly chilled butter._ If your butter is too soft, you'll have to refrigerate the dough for longer. It will only take a few seconds to soften it in the mixer. _Weigh your dry ingredients._ If you have a scale, now's a good time to use it. Weighing flour is more accurate than using measuring cups because there may be more or less air than you need taking up space in measuring cups. If you use too much flour in the dough, your cookies may end up too dry or crispy, when they should come out soft. If you can sift your flour, even better! _Don't overmix the cookie dough._ When you stir the flour mixture into the wet ingredients, bring them together until just combined. You should still see some flour in your mixing bowl. Overmixing adds aeration which means your cookies will rise and then fall. _Make a thick dough._ Make sure that your dough is thick when you roll it out. These cookies should be puffy. If the dough is too thin, they may burn. _Watch the baking time._ Be sure to watch your cookies in the last few minutes and bake until the edges are just browned. At this point, they're done (if they start to brown on top they're overcooked). _Hold the frosting._ Allow the cookies to cool completely before frosting. Otherwise, you'll risk melting the frosting and it won't stay put on the cookie. ## Variations Want to customize your sugar cookie recipe? Try one of these fun options: _Frosting:_ Use a variety of colors or stick to a theme, depending on the occasion. _Sprinkles (an optional — but highly recommended — step)_: Is there anything more joyful than rainbow sprinkles? Maybe heart sprinkles for Valentine's Day or pumpkins for Halloween! _Shapes:_ Use a cookie cutter to create fun shapes and different sizes. _Go gluten-free:_ Feel free to swap the all-purpose flour for gluten-free flour with a 1:1 ratio to make these cookies gluten-free.

HOW TO MAKE SUGAR COOKIE FROSTING - BETTYCROCKER.COM
Nov 16, 2021 · Step 2: For your sugar cookie frosting, stir in your vanilla and one tablespoon of milk. Once mixed, gradually beat in the remaining milk to make the frosting smooth and spreadable. If the sugar cookie icing seems too thick, beat in additional milk a few drops at a time. If the frosting becomes too thin, beat in a small amount of powdered sugar.
